| This course is designed to provide a comprehensive understanding of Canadian privacy laws and best practices, specifically as they pertain to workplace environments. The objective is to equip participants with the knowledge and tools to navigate privacy obligations in managing employee data, ensuring compliance with applicable laws, and protecting the rights of employees in accordance with Canadian privacy legislation.
